Malachi 1:2-5 - An Oracle Against Edom

2 "I have loved you," says Yahweh, but you say, "How have you loved us?" "[Is] Esau not Jacob's brother?" {declares} Yahweh. "I have loved Jacob, 3 but Esau I have hated. I have made his mountain ranges a desolation, and [given] his inheritance to the jackals of [the] desert."

4 If Edom says, "We are shattered, but we will return and rebuild [the] ruins," Yahweh of hosts says this: "They may build, but I will tear down; and they will be called a territory of wickedness, and the people [with] whom Yahweh is angry forever." 5 Your eyes will see [this], and you will say, "Yahweh is great beyond the borders of Israel."
